After the surgical treatment of swollen hocks in cattle, the hock is bandaged for about 5 days and the skin sutures are removed after 14days. The immediate effect of surgery is that the hock becomes profoundly flexed. During this period great care and hygiene ... Nettet6. aug. 2015 · Claw health, an important dairy cow welfare parameter, may be affected by early-life foot/leg stresses. To investigate this, groups of pregnant heifers were allocated to deep straw bedding (Soft) or cubicles (Hard), both with scraped concrete feeding alleys. After the grazing season, they were re-housed in cubicle systems, half on slatted …

Nettet2. feb. 2024 · The ham hock, which is used extensively in southern U.S. cuisine, is taken from the joint at the shank end of the ham where it joins the foot. The ham hock is often braised with collards or other greens. What part of an animal is the hock? The hock, or gambrel, is the joint between the tarsal bones and tibia of a digitigrade or unguligrade quadrupedal mammal, such as a horse, cat, or dog.
